Abstract

In this paper, a novel waveguide array antenna composed of non-inclined slots in the narrow wall of the waveguide, which are excited with rectangular Iris is introduced. This new method in addition to improving impedance and radiation characteristics has an easy production process. Also, because of using non-inclined slots, the antenna has very low cross polarization level. In this paper, in the first step, suitable radiating elements for designing a linear slot array antenna were considered, and then a linear array suitable surveillance radar with 136 elements with Taylor distribution is designed and simulated with HFSS at the frequency of (2.7 - 3.1) GHz. Finally, the antenna has been fabricated and tested. The results of the test and simulation are in good agreement.
